French cuisine is renowned worldwide for its exquisite flavors, culinary techniques, and rich traditions. It is often considered one of the finest and most influential cuisines globally. Here are some key elements and dishes associated with French cuisine:
Ingredients: French cuisine places a strong emphasis on high-quality, fresh ingredients. The country's diverse regions provide an abundance of ingredients, including fresh vegetables, herbs, meats, seafood, and dairy products.
Sauces: French cuisine is famous for its rich and flavorful sauces. Some classic French sauces include Béchamel, Velouté, Hollandaise, and Béarnaise, to name a few. These sauces are often used to enhance the flavors of various dishes.
Techniques: French cooking techniques are considered some of the most refined and precise in the world. These techniques include sautéing, roasting, grilling, poaching, and braising. French chefs also pay great attention to knife skills and presentation.
Bread and Pastry: French bread, especially baguettes, is world-famous for its crispy crust and soft interior. Pastries are also a highlight of French cuisine, with croissants, éclairs, tarts, and macarons being popular choices.
Cheese: France is renowned for its extensive variety of cheeses. From creamy Brie to pungent Roquefort, there's a cheese to suit every palate. Cheese is often enjoyed before or after a meal.
Wine: France is one of the world's leading wine producers, and wine is an integral part of French dining culture. Each region specializes in different types of wine, such as Bordeaux, Burgundy, Champagne, and the Loire Valley.
Regional Cuisine: France's diverse regions each have their own unique culinary traditions and specialties. For example, Provence is known for its Mediterranean-inspired dishes, while Alsace offers hearty German-influenced cuisine.
Famous Dishes: French cuisine boasts a wide range of iconic dishes, including Coq au Vin (chicken in red wine), Bouillabaisse (fish stew), Ratatouille (vegetable medley), Quiche Lorraine, and Crème Brûlée.
Dining Culture: French dining is often a leisurely and social affair. The French take time to savor their meals and enjoy the company of friends and family. Meals are typically served in multiple courses, including appetizers, main courses, cheese, and dessert.
Culinary Schools: France is home to some of the world's most prestigious culinary schools, such as Le Cordon Bleu. Many top chefs and culinary professionals from around the world train in France to learn its culinary techniques.
French cuisine continues to evolve while preserving its traditions and high standards of quality. It has had a profound influence on global gastronomy and remains a source of inspiration for chefs and food enthusiasts worldwide.
